About this Event

Some pain is hard to see. All of it is real.

Join Represent Justice for The Root to Silence: From Awareness to Action, an evening centered on listening, learning and breaking the silence around pain, mental health and suicide prevention.

The event will feature a screening of Loud Silence, followed by a meaningful panel discussion and community conversation designed to move beyond awareness and toward action.

Event Details
📅 Thursday, September 24, 2026
🚪 Doors Open: 5:30 PM
🕕 Program: 6:00–7:30 PM
📍 Institute for the Preservation of African-American Music & Arts
3200 W. Hampton Ave.

Guests can expect a film screening, panel discussion, community conversations and light refreshments.

This is an opportunity to come together, listen to real experiences, learn from one another and explore how we can better support individuals and communities experiencing pain.

Let’s listen. Let’s learn. Let’s act. Let’s break the silence.

Presented in partnership with Advance Peace and Prevent Suicide Greater Milwaukee (PSGM).
